Accounting polieies
Basis of preparation
The financial statements have b¢¢n prepared on thc historical cost basis, as modified by the
revaluation of certain financial assets and liabilities and invesimcnt propcrties measured at fair
value through income or expenditure.
The financiaj statements are prepared in sterlin& which is the functional currency of the entity.
Going concern
There are no material uncertainties about the charity's ability to continue.
Judgements and key sources of estimation uncertainty
The preparation of the financial statements requires trustees to make judgements. estimates and
assumptions that affect the amounts reported. These estimates and judgements are continually
reviewed and are based on experience and other factors, including expectations of future events
that are believed to be reasonable under the circumstances.
The trustees do not consider there are any critical judwents or sources of estimation uncertainty
requiring disclosure beyond the accounting policies listed below.
Fund accounting
Unrestricted funds are available for use at the discretion of the trustees to further any of the
charity's pu￿)Ses.
Designated funds are unrestricted funds earmarked by the trustees for particular ￿tllre project or
commitment.
Restricted funds are subjected to restrictions on their expenditure declared by the donor or
through the ternis of an appeal, and fall into one of two sub-cla8ses: restricted income funds or
endowment funds.

Accounting policies (eonlinued)
Incoming resources
All incoming resources are included in the statement of financial activities when entitlcment has
passed to the charity. it is probable that the economic benefits associated witli tlie transaction will
flow to tlie charity and the amount can be reliably measured. The following specific policies are
applied to particular cat¢gories of income:
income from donations or grants is recognised when there is evidence of entitlement to th¢
gift. receipt is probable and its amount can be measured reliably.
legacy income is reCO￿lSed when reccipt is probable and entitlement is establish¢d.
income from donated goods is m¢asured at the fair value of the goods unless this is
impractical to measure rcliably, in which casc the value is derived from thc cost to the
donor or the estimated resale value. Donated facilities and services are recognised in the
accounts whcn received if the value can be reliably measured. No amounts are included for
the contribution of general volunteers.
income from contracts for the supply of services is recognised with the delivery of the
contracted service. This is olassified as unrestricted fijnds unless there is a contractual
requirement for it to be spent on a particular purpose and returned if unspent, in which case
it may be regarded as restricted.
Resources expended
Expenditure is recognised on an accruals basis as a liability is incurred. Expenditure includes any
VAT which cannot be fully recovered, and is classified under headings of the statement of
financial activities to which it relates:
expenditure on raising funds includes the costs of all fundraising activities, events.
non-charitable trading activities, and the sale of donated goods.
expenditure on charitable activities includes all costs incurred by a charity in undertaking
activÉties that further its Ch￿itable aims for the benefit of its beneficiaries, including those
support costs and costs relating to the governance of the charity apportioned to Ch￿itable
activities.
other expenditure includes all expenditure that is neither related to raising funds for the
charity nor part of its expenditure on charitable activities.
All costs are allocated to expenditure categories reflecting the ￿Se of th¢ resource. Direct costs
attributable to a single activity are allocat¢d directly to that activity. Shared costs are apportioned
between the activities they contribute to on a reasonable, justifiable and consistent basis.

Accounting policies (cofttlnued)
Financial instruments
A financial asset or a financial liability is recognised only when the entity becomes a party to the
contractual provisions of the instrument.
Basic financial instruments ￿ initially recognised at the amount receivable or payable including
any related transaction costs, unless the arrangement Constitutes a financing transaction, where it
is recognised at the present value of the future payinents discouiited al a market rate of interest
for a similar debt instrument.
Current assets and current liabilities are subsequently measured at the cash or other consideration
expected to be paid or received and not discounted.
Debt instniments are subsequently measured at amortised cost.
